MakerDAO governs DAI, a USD-pegged stablecoin, with the help of MKR governance tokens. MKR holders deal with the provision and liquidity of DAI by a mint or burn off course of action. In addition they determine collateral for lending and borrowing and judge the DAI savings amount i.e. fascination paid out for locking up DAI, etcetera.

I get why people might would like to pool their cash to order stuff. But why is a totally new, copyright-centered governance structure essential for that? Couldn’t They simply use a normal crowdfunding internet site? they may. And, in some instances, a DAO could possibly be superior off employing a System like Kickstarter, mainly because employing copyright to boost large quantities of dollars can lead to buyers shelling out exorbitant transaction costs. When ConstitutionDAO raised $forty seven million, such as, its customers paid out around $one.2 million in costs into the Ethereum network. Ouch. Are there almost every other downsides to DAOs? Some DAOs have found that decentralized, blockchain-primarily based governance is messier than it appears to be like. The first-at any time DAO, which was basically known as the DAO, elevated a lot more than $150 million to make a sort of crowdfunded investment organization, then went up in flames amid a number of lawful, governance and protection troubles. identical challenges have plagued other DAOs due to the fact then. DAOs can also run into lawful trouble if regulators decide the tokens they difficulty are securities, thus necessitating them to go in the exact registration system as a company offering stocks or bonds. In 2017, the Securities and Trade Commission identified that DAO Tokens, the native token from the DAO, were being in truth securities, and should have been subject to securities law. The modern DAO growth has also raised eyebrows amid regulators and legislation enforcement agencies, who're anxious that some DAOs could just be fronts for fraud. “in some instances, copyright investors and regulators say, the ventures volume to Ponzi strategies meant to do small greater than bolster the worth in the digital tokens they promote,” my colleagues Eric Lipton and Ephrat Livni wrote in the new piece on many of the issues facing DAOs. Even some copyright admirers have argued that DAOs haven’t yet proved they can do over allocating copyright to copyright-associated tasks.
